<p class="x_MsoNormal"><span style="font-size:12.0pt">In the RF area, cabling to the 3<sup>rd</sup> transmitter console continued, the console was connected to AC power, circulator installation continued, and acceptance testing of the first 3 MW klystron progressed
at the RF Test Facility. In the SCL area, three cavities have qualified at Jefferson Lab for the 8<sup>th</sup> cryomodule. Procedures were developed for the repair of a return end can at ORNL, and u-tube components are being shipped to Jefferson Lab from
the vendor. In the ring area, the 3<sup>rd</sup> chicane magnet windings were potted at Fermilab, and magnetic field measurements progressed. In the target area, electron beam weld development has gone well, and the results will be applied to the 2 MW targets
presently in fabrication. The mercury overflow tank and ortho/para conversion vessel are nearly complete, and delivery is expected within the next month.</span><span style="font-size:12.0pt"></span></p>
